Krithi: Venugana Loluni
Ragam: Kedaragowla
Thalam: Rupakam
Composer: Thyagaraja
Live courtesy: Kshethram Media

Pallavi:
Venugaana Loluni Gana Veyi Kannulu Gaavalene

Anupallavi
(Ali) Venulella Drishti Chutti Veyuchu Mrokkuchu Raaga

Charanam
Vikasita Pankaja Vadanulu Vividha Gatula Naadaka
Nokari Kokaru Karamunanidi Yora Kanula Judaga
Sukha Ravamulu Gala Tarunulu Sogagasugaanu Baadaga
Sakala Surulu Tyaagaraaja Sakhuni Vedaga Vacche

Meaning:

We need a thousand eyes to absorb the beauty and grace of Sri Krishna, who is so fond of playing on the flute.
Like charming ladies with tresses decorated with fragrant flowers around which honey bees hum. Wave before him Saffron water to ward off the effects of the evil eyes.
This youth of surpassing beauty is the cynosure of a grand procession. Women of ravishing beauty precede Him, dancing hand-in-hand to diverse rhythms . Now and then they glance at Him shyly through the corner of their eyes , and move on singing sweetly in parrot-like voices. The host of celestials watch from above in reverent homage, this magnificent spectacle of extraordinary grandeur!
